Overview of the Lunch Program

The NNPS lunch program is designed to promote healthy eating habits by providing meals r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and low-fat dairy products. The program also accommodates students with allergies and dietary restrictions through alternative meal options.

Participation in the lunch program is easy, and free or reduced-price meals are available to eligible families. NNPS strives to make nutritious meals accessible to all students, helping reduce food insecurity and promote equity.

Key Features of the Lunch Program:

  • Monthly rotating menus with seasonal and fresh ingredients
  • Options for vegetarian and allergen-sensitive diets
  • Compliance with USDA nutritional standards
  • Free or reduced-price meals based on family income
  • Educational initiatives that encourage healthy eating habits

Nutritional Guidelines and Standards

Newport News Public Schools adheres strictly to the USDA’s National School Lunch Program standards. These standards ensure that meals served are nutritionally balanced and support the growth and development of children and adolescents.

Each meal provides a balance of macronutrients and essential vitamins and minerals. The guidelines restrict sodium, saturated fat, and trans fats, while promoting fiber, calcium, iron, and protein intake.

The lunch program also incorporates the MyPlate framework, encouraging students to fill half their plates with fruits and vegetables and choose whole grains and lean proteins.

USDA Nutritional Requirements Included in the Menu

  • Caloric limits appropriate to age groups
  • At least ½ cup of fruit and ¾ cup of vegetables daily
  • Whole grains in at least half of the grain servings
  • Fat-free or low-fat milk options
  • Reduction of sodium and saturated fat levels

Special Dietary Accommodations

NNPS is committed to ensuring that all students have access to healthy meals, regardless of allergies, medical conditions, or lifestyle choices. The district provides options and accommodations for students with special dietary needs.

Families are encouraged to communicate with the school nutrition services department if their child requires:

  • Gluten-free meals
  • Dairy-free or lactose intolerance accommodations
  • Vegetarian or vegan options
  • Nut-free or allergy-sensitive meals
  • Other medically necessary dietary modifications with physician documentation

These accommodations are handled with care and confidentiality to ensure the safety and wellbeing of each student.

Nutrition Education and Student Engagement

Beyond meal provision, Newport News Public Schools actively promotes nutrition education to empower students to make healthy choices. Programs include classroom lessons, taste tests, and garden initiatives that connect students with the food they eat.

Students are encouraged to participate in surveys and provide feedback on menu items, helping nutrition staff tailor offerings to student preferences without compromising health standards.

Examples of Engagement Initiatives:

  • Farm-to-School programs that introduce fresh, local produce
  • Cooking demonstrations and nutrition workshops
  • Seasonal “Taste of the Month” events
  • Collaborations with parents and community partners

Seasonal and Special Event Menus

NNPS celebrates holidays and cultural events with special themed menus that highlight diverse cuisines and festive foods. These menus provide cultural education alongside nutritional value.

For example, during Hispanic Heritage Month, the lunch program may include traditional dishes such as arroz con pollo or black beans and rice. During winter holidays, special desserts and seasonal fruits are offered.

These special menus are designed to be fun and engaging while maintaining the commitment to healthy ingredients and balanced meals.
